Gift Benefits K-State Cancer Research

Friday November 5, 2010

The late David and Janice von Riesen have made gifts through the Janice W. von Riesen Trust of more than $325,000 to Kansas State University’s A.Q. Miller School of Journalism and Mass Communications and Terry C. Johnson Center for Basic Cancer Research. These gifts establish the David R. and Janice W. von Riesen Scholarship in Journalism and Mass Communications and the David R. and Janice W. von Riesen Cancer Research Fund.

he scholarship in journalism and mass communications will benefit K-State undergraduates in the A.Q. Miller School of Journalism and Mass Communications. The cancer research fund will be used to support cancer research at K-State.
